Triggers

When this happens…

Figma
  • Dev Mode Status Updated Real-time
    Fires when a layer is marked as "Ready for Dev", "Completed", or has its Dev Mode status cleared. Useful for triggering handoff notifications to developers or updating project tracking tools.
  • File Deleted Real-time
    Fires when any file within the subscribed context is deleted. Useful for cleanup workflows, audit logging, or triggering alerts.
  • File Updated Real-time
    Fires when any change is saved to a file within the subscribed context. Use this to trigger downstream syncs, notifications, or exports whenever a designer updates their work.
  • File Version Created Real-time
    Fires when a designer explicitly saves a named version (via File → Save to Version History). Useful for triggering handoff, snapshot archival, or approval workflows.
  • Library Published Real-time
    Fires when components, styles, or variables are published from a library file. A separate event fires per asset type (components, styles, variables). Useful for syncing design tokens, triggering Storybook updates, or notifying dev teams of design system changes.
  • New File Comment Real-time
    Fires whenever a user adds a comment or reply to any file within the subscribed team, project, or file context. Useful for routing design feedback to Slack, Jira, or email.

Actions

Do this…

Figma
  • Create Dev Resources
    Attaches one or more dev resources (external URLs like tickets, PRs, or documentation) to specific nodes in a Figma file.
  • Create Webhook
    Creates a webhook that sends a POST request to your endpoint when the specified event fires. A PING event is sent immediately upon creation to verify the endpoint. Webhooks can be attached to a team, project, or individual file.
  • Delete Comment
    Permanently deletes a comment. Only the author of the comment can delete it.
  • Delete Dev Resource
    Permanently deletes a dev resource attachment from a Figma node.
  • Delete Webhook
    Deletes the specified webhook. This action is irreversible. The webhook will immediately stop sending events.
  • Get Activity Logs
    Returns audit/activity log entries for the organization. Requires Enterprise plan and Figma for Government base URL. Supports filtering by event type and date range.
  • Get Comments
    Returns all comments left on a file, including their author, position, thread structure, and creation timestamp.
  • Get Component by Key
    Returns detailed metadata for a specific published component identified by its component key.
  • Get Current User
    Returns the Figma account details (ID, email, handle, avatar) for the user or application that owns the access token.
  • Get Dev Resources
    Returns dev resources (external links like Jira tickets, PRs, docs) attached to specific nodes in a file. Optionally filter by node IDs.
  • Get File
    Returns the complete document tree for a Figma file as JSON, including all nodes, components, styles, and metadata. Supports filtering by node IDs and tree depth to limit response size.
  • Get File Components
    Returns all component metadata published from the given file.
  • Get File Metadata
    Returns file metadata including name, last touched info, creator, and thumbnail URL. Much lighter than Get File — no document tree included.
  • Get File Nodes
    Returns the JSON subtrees for specified node IDs in a Figma file, along with their component and style metadata.
  • Get File Styles
    Returns style metadata for all styles published from the given file.
  • Get File Versions
    Returns a paginated list of all saved versions for a file, ordered by creation date (newest first). Each version includes the version ID, label, description, and the user who created it.
  • Get Image Fill URLs
    Returns a mapping of image references to signed S3 download URLs for all images used as fills in the file. URLs expire within 14 days.
  • Get Local Variables
    Returns all local variables created in the file plus any remote variables used in the file. Enterprise plan required.
  • Get Project Files
    Returns a list of files within a project. Each file entry includes its key, name, thumbnail, and last modified date.
  • Get Published Variables
    Returns all variables and variable collections published from the file. Enterprise plan required.
  • Get Style by Key
    Returns detailed metadata for a specific published style by its key.
  • Get Team Components
    Returns metadata for all components published to a team library, including component name, description, thumbnail, and linked file.
  • Get Team Projects
    Returns a list of projects for the specified team. Requires the projects:read scope. Note: Project endpoints require approval from Figma for new apps.
  • Get Team Styles
    Returns metadata for all styles (fill, text, effect, grid) published to a team library.
  • Get Webhook
    Returns the full details of a registered webhook by its ID.
  • Get Webhook Request Log
    Returns all event payloads sent by a webhook in the past week. Useful for debugging delivery failures or verifying event structure.
  • List Webhooks
    Returns all webhooks attached to a specific context. Alternatively, use plan_api_id to list all webhooks across all contexts.
  • Post Comment
    Posts a new top-level comment or reply on a Figma file. You can optionally anchor the comment to a specific position on the canvas or reply to an existing root comment.
  • Post Comment Reaction
    Adds an emoji reaction to an existing comment. Accepts standard emoji shortcodes such as :heart: or :+1:.
  • Render Images from File
    Renders the specified nodes as images and returns download URLs. Supports JPG, PNG, SVG, and PDF output formats. Exported image URLs expire after 30 days.
  • Update Webhook
    Updates one or more properties (event type, endpoint, passcode, status, or description) of an existing webhook.
